Arthur Conan Doyle's A Study in Scarlet — the novel that introduced the world to Sherlock Holmes — reimagined as a stunning illustrated special edition hardcover by Hipkiss Publishing House.

When Dr John Watson returns from Afghanistan, he finds himself sharing lodgings at 221B Baker Street with the brilliant, eccentric Sherlock Holmes. Their first case together plunges them into a baffling murder mystery that stretches from the foggy streets of London to the deserts of Utah. Sharp, gripping, and endlessly clever, A Study in Scarlet is where the greatest detective in fiction was born.

First published in 1887, A Study in Scarlet launched one of the most beloved characters in literary history. Sherlock Holmes has since appeared in four novels and 56 short stories, inspiring countless adaptations across film, television, and stage.
